+1 ySome Republicans didn't like that McCarthy caved into some of the Democrats' demands when avoiding the government shutdown. Per new rules established just this past January (that's what helped McCarthy get enough votes to be named Speaker), only one Representative can call for an ouster vote, and that's what happened. Voting was mostly along party lines, with Republican Representatives basically getting rid of their leader.
Now, McHenry is Speaker pro tempore and will serve in that post until a new Speaker is voted in. Interestingly, McCarthy could be voted back in as Speaker. Until a new vote is held, McHenry (as pro tem) has most of the powers of a real Speaker.
